Error occurs in Microsoft Word Action - Convert Word Document to PDF

(8)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 27
All my flows that has this particular action began to fail tonight. All with the same error of unsupported media type. The document is a word document created by the sharepoint create file action earlier (also see attached).

    @w.p @EI-30071734-0 I've tried it with OneDrive action and it still fails: 
    {
     "status"406,
      "message""Conversion of this file to PDF is not supported. (cannotOpenFile / Error from Office Service. Url=https://euc.wordcs.officeapps.live.com/document/export/pdf HttpCode=UnsupportedMediaType)",
      "source""api.connectorp.svc.ms"
    }
     
    Now this is affecting many other flows with different templates so i don't think the template is the issue. The file itself opens correctly and its not corrupted.

    Likewise started suddenly getting the same error after yesterday. Converting a Word template saved to SharePoint into a pdf fails with the unsupported media type error. Neither the template nor flow in use have been changed since December 2024 and were working reliably.
     
    I did some testing with Word templates and the connector in an other flow.
    • The Word template that is giving the error, kept giving the error even after stripped of all content and controls
    • Uploading an empty Word document to SharePoint and trying to convert that to pdf also gives unsupported media type error
    • Empty word document that is created in SharePoint, downloaded and having controls added to it, and then uploaded back to SharePoint can be converted to pdf
      • However, copying any controls from the old template during this process makes the word template give unsupported media type error again
     
    So it seems there were some sudden changes in the Convert Word Document to PDF action that broke the processing for existing Word Templates.
     
    Why are the existing Word Templates suddenly not working with the Convert to PDF action? Especially since the Populate Word Template action of the same Word Online (Business) connector is still working normally with the same templates.
     
    Why is it not possible to convert a Word Document that is created locally, but one created in SharePoint can be? The error only mentions that the document could be "restricted". How can you check this in SharePoint?

    When the word document has "Content Control". it will throw this error "Unsupported Media type".
    It started happening to me as well after 30th of July...
     
    Created a new word file without content control, works.
    Created a new word file with content control, hit the same error..
